Cleveland-Cliffs Inc. (NYSE:CLF – Get Free Report) EVP Celso Goncalves, Jr. sold 214,308 shares of Cleveland-Cliffs stock in a transaction on Friday, June 5th. The stock was sold at an average price of $13.41, for a total transaction of $2,873,870.28. Following the transaction, the executive vice president directly owned 184,542 shares in the company, valued at approximately $2,474,708.22. This represents a 53.73% decrease in their ownership of the stock. The sale was disclosed in a fil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ission, which is accessible through this link.

Cleveland-Cliffs (NYSE:CLF – Get Free Report) last released its earnings results on Monday, April 20th. The mining company reported ($0.40) ear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, beating analysts’ consensus estimates of ($0.44) by $0.04. Cleveland-Cliffs had a negative return on equity of 15.48% and a negative net margin of 6.42%.The business had revenue of $4.92 billion for the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$4.84 billion. During the same quarter in the previous year, the business earned ($0.92) earnings per share. Cleveland-Cliffs’s quarterly revenue was up 6.3% on a year-over-year basis. On average, sell-side analysts forecast that Cleveland-Cliffs Inc. will post -0.46 EPS for the current fiscal year.

About Cleveland-Cliffs
Cleveland-Cliffs Inc is a leading North American producer of iron ore pellets and flat-rolled steel products. Tracing its roots to 1847, the company has evolved from an iron-ore mining concern in the Great Lakes region into a fully integrated steelmaker. Today, Cleveland-Cliffs operates iron ore mining complexes in Michigan and Minnesota as well as steelmaking and finishing facilities across the United States.
The company’s integrated platform begins with direct control of key raw materials, including iron ore and scrap, and extends through every stage of steel production.
